Our members face a range of challenges and issues which impact their ability to grow and do business. Our policy and representation work connects directly with central government, local government, policymakers and influencers. Simply put, we are a powerful platform which amplifies the voice of the local business community and ensures that the needs of Black Country firms are listened to and taken seriously.
Our Work
As one of 53 Chambers within the British Chambers of Commerce network, we have run a number of local campaigns and projects and meet regularly with politicians and decision makers to create a powerful platform for the region’s business community.
